As I said in my earlier email:

Unless users choose to install clang, bpf will always fail run without
clang. So clang dependency is an issue for bpf test coverage in general.
That is your choice as to whether you want to increase the scope of
regression test coverage for bpf or not.

I fully understand you have weigh that against ease of writing tests.

We can leave things the way they are since:

- You can't force users to install clang and run bpf test. Users might
  opt for letting bpf test fail due to unmet dependency.

- You have reasons to continue use clang and you have been using it for
  a longtime.

I will try to see why make ksefltest fails on bpf even with my patch
series that addresses the source directory issue. All other tests build
and run. It is not an issue with bpf specifically, it is something that
has never been tested in this use-case.

	Cong's patch is wrong for few reasons:

- it will stop to kfree non-refcounted metrics

- report was for IPV6 and we set DST_METRICS_REFCOUNTED only
for IPv4, for DST_METRICS_READ_ONLY metrics

- __dst_destroy_metrics_generic is called for val without
DST_METRICS_READ_ONLY flag and such metrics are not with
DST_METRICS_REFCOUNTED flag

- ->cow_metrics and dst_cow_metrics_generic are called with 
DST_METRICS_READ_ONLY flag set, there is no chance to write
new value twice, especially to write DST_METRICS_REFCOUNTED flag
and later to see this flag in __dst_destroy_metrics_generic

	So, I'm not sure where exactly is the bug with the
metrics.
